NICOLE MARIA is a 27.43 m Sail Yacht, built in Norway by Anker & Jensen and delivered in 1931.

Her top speed is 10.0 kn and she boasts a maximum range of 500.0 nm when navigating at cruising speed, with power coming from a Caterpillar diesel engine. She can accommodate up to 6 guests in 3 staterooms, with 3 crew members waiting on their every need. She has a gross tonnage of 61.6 GT and a 4.75 m beam.

She was designed by Johan Anker, who also completed the naval architecture. Johan Anker has designed 1 yacht and created the naval architecture for 1 yacht for yachts above 24 metres.
